By using the CT-OP (Controlled Over-Pressure) sintering furnace, Sumitomo Electric (SEI) succeeded in improving various characteristics such as critical current and mechanical properties of Ag sheath Bi-2223 wire commercialized as DI-BSCCO. Recently, SEI has developed and commercialized high strength DI-BSCCO Type HT-NX wire reinforced with the Ni alloy tapes and has applied the residual axial compression after lamination. The critical tensile stress of Type HT-NX has reached 400 MPa at 77 K. For high field magnetic application such as NMR using Bi-2223 based superconducting wire reinforced with Ni alloy tapes is highly expected.
